Simon Hong is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Genetics and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Simon Hong has authored 41 papers receiving a total of 1.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Epidemiology, 14 papers in Genetics and 13 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Simon Hong’s work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(14 papers), Microscopic Colitis (13 papers) and Neural dynamics and brain function (8 papers). Simon Hong is often cited by papers focused on Inflammatory Bowel Disease (14 papers), Microscopic Colitis (13 papers) and Neural dynamics and brain function (8 papers). Simon Hong collaborates with scholars based in United States, Japan and Türkiye. Simon Hong's co-authors include Okihide Hikosaka, David Hudesman, Sam S. Chang, Lance M. Optican and Jordan E. Axelrad and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Neuron and Journal of Neuroscience.
